U.S., March 18 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T06879119) titled 'Clinical Evaluation of Localized Scalp Thread Embedding for Male Androgenetic Alopecia' on March 11.

Brief Summary: This clinical study aims to evaluate a breakthrough treatment for hair loss (androgenetic alopecia, AGA) using dissolvable threads placed under the scalp skin. We hypothesize that these specially designed threads can improve hair growth, avoiding the need for invasive surgery.
